Transaction 93b84bb1305a738fd56811972e7fceb111c5baafa076c4a0731703a0daa51558
1 Input
1 Output
-
93b84bb1305a738fd56811972e7fceb111c5baafa076c4a0731703a0daa51558:0
- value
- 603877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74e5b32fc92810407a6f01285b005e031c92eb25 OP_EQUAL
- address
- 3CM7UdPiDs7aJiiFjtqug2g2mAmu2oY7Py